Feature → Business Impact → Application: The 3P 800 A Moulded Case Circuit Breaker provides robust overload protection with a compact footprint, simplifying panel wiring and reducing assembly time in harsh plant environments; this translates to lower installation costs and faster commissioning in electrical cabinets. The PR232/P-LSI solid-state release enhances trip accuracy and fault discrimination, improving safety and uptime for critical feeders such as motors and transformers. With front-terminal access, wiring becomes easier in tight panels, supporting easier upgrades and maintenance during PM windows. Electrical durability of 3000 cycles and mechanical durability of 10000 cycles deliver longer service life in demanding factories, reducing replacement intervals and total cost of ownership. The device’s 8 kV impulse rating, 690 V operating voltage, and 45 kA Ics (at 690 V) plus 60 kA Icu enable reliable coordination in medium- and high-power distribution networks. RoHS, REACH, and CMRT declarations provide regulatory confidence for global deployments, while a 32 W per pole power loss helps minimize standby energy waste. This is a fixed, three-pole MCCB with front-terminal connections. It is designed for 690 V AC systems and 800 A continuous operation, suitable for panel installations that require straightforward wiring, easy access to terminals, and compatibility with Tmax T family configurations.
Key specs include rated current 800 A, rated operational voltage 690 V AC, rated insulation voltage 1000 V, eight-kilovolt impulse withstand (Uimp) and 32 W per pole power loss. Short-circuit performance includes Ics up to 45 kA at 690 V and Icu up to 60 kA at 690 V, with Icw 15 kA for 1 s.
